Every child and teenager is dead in the town of Springwood, Ohio. However, not the thirtysomethings that makeup our Halloweenies team. Join them as they try to make sense of the Krueger family tree within 1991's Freddy's Dead: The Final Nightmare. Together, they discuss its bad reputation, the useless 3-D, and whether or not it's truly the final chapter. Follow us on Facebook | Twitter | Instagram | Patreon Hosted on Acast.
